i have been getting these 'renew your account info' emails for a couple weeks now about renewing my account info from ebay.

they want info that includes credit card #'s and so on. is this a scam similar to the Paypal scam that went out a few weeks back, or is it for real?



shrinkboy
 
It's a scam.
Ebay will NEVER ask for that info. Check back for other threads on this and email the email to spoof@ebay.com so they can check it out.

Generally, when you open mail that has any HTML in it you actually send a ping of sorts back to them indicating that not only that you've looked at their garbage, but that your e-mail is active.

There are known cases of viruses being embedded within HTML, so for your own good, turn that feature off in whatever e-mail program you use.
